Urgent hire - Embedded C++/C Linux Software Engineer - £50k - £55k

Embedded/Firmware Software Developer - C/C++ 5 Days Onsite - Evesham, Worcestershire Powering the Smart Grid RevolutionAre you a creative and driven Embedded Software Engineer ready to shape the future of energy technology?Join a dynamic product development team working at the forefront of smart grid innovation. My clients cutting-edge monitoring and control systems are deployed in electricity substations and control rooms worldwide, helping utility providers deliver more reliable, secure, and sustainable power networks.Their looking for a seasoned Embedded/Firmware Developer with a passion for solving real-world engineering challenges. You''ll be working hands-on with microcontrollers, Embedded Linux, and secure communication protocols to build robust, scalable solutions for the Electricity Distribution Industry and its evolving needs. What You''ll Bring:5+ years of Embedded Software Development experienceStrong C/C++ skillsExpertise with Microchip PIC and/or STM32 microcontrollersAbility to interpret circuit schematics and use oscilloscopes/logic analysersExperience with Embedded Linux (Buildroot or similar)A strong focus on secure coding practices Bonus Skills (Not Essential, But Awesome to Have):RS485, RS232, USBGSM/GPRS/3G, TCP/IP, SSL/TLSOTA firmware updatesRTOS (eg, FreeRTOS), MODBUS, DNP3.0Automated build/test environmentsBrushless DC motor controlMISRA/C++ standards Why This Role?Be part of a tight-knit, agile team where your ideas matterWork on mission-critical ..... full job details .....